Review: The Casual Vacancy

on September 30, 2012

The Casual Vacancy
The Casual Vacancy by J.K. Rowling
My rating: 2 of 5 stars

Yep, you didn’t see that wrong – I’ve given this only 2 stars. I know, I know, it’s JKR, but this is what I honestly felt after finishing the book.

I didn’t expect a lot in terms of the actual prose, so that part I guess is ok. But I did expect a great story. I mean, isn’t that the whole deal about being JKR! Unfortunately, I didn’t find the story THAT engrossing. The characters themselves are built beautifully – by the time I got introduced to all of them, I already had strong feelings on who I liked and who I didn’t. But somehow, the story was very common-place and insipid. I expected lots of twists and turns, scandals, etc, but.. well.. none of that sort here!

And the way it ended was very abrupt. I actually turned a page after the last paragraph to be sure I read till the end and there wasn’t anything left!

A British version of Desperate Housewives, is all I can say. It would actually make a pretty good drama series on TV! :-P
